Output fef90ba156e0127d8b421da52128f85204eef0e8a1364c204b40ce0a33071064:1

value
66568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3532d0f2dbf902cf6187e006282f3b363e18986 OP_EQUAL
address
2NDyD1zxkGnjDQBx5qWijS14quYPNqsu91s
transaction
fef90ba156e0127d8b421da52128f85204eef0e8a1364c204b40ce0a33071064